Output d65ad8b32709d31df68b0779afa653fa31d3b9dff73de29f87e8a041018460ab:0

value
962533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6683584070feb1081b6f5c1df27b67cd677dca67 OP_EQUAL
address
3B34C6u7fUR2RAkrihssqF8JPqJ5KzzEpw
transaction
d65ad8b32709d31df68b0779afa653fa31d3b9dff73de29f87e8a041018460ab
confirmations
176109
spent
true